Background
Strollers typically include a frame that is convertible between an expanded position and a collapsed position, and a seat attached to the frame. The seat generally includes a sitting portion and a backrest having a lower end pivotally connected to a rear side of the sitting portion, the seat may be a single body, that is, the entire seat may be assembled to the frame, and the seat and the frame may be detachably connected (i.e., the entire seat may be assembled to or disassembled from the frame), rotatably connected (i.e., the entire seat may rotate relative to the frame), and connected in a forward-backward direction (i.e., the entire seat may be disposed forward or backward relative to the frame), and generally the sitting portion is connected to the frame; there are also seats, the seat part of which is fixedly connected with the relevant components of the frame, and the above-mentioned operations of disassembly, rotation and reversing cannot be carried out, namely, the seat part and the frame are integrated.
Regardless of how the seat is connected with the frame, the inclination angle of the backrest of the seat of the common baby carriage relative to the sitting part can be adjusted, namely the backrest angle can be adjusted, but the up-and-down height of the backrest of the common baby carriage is fixed, namely the size of the backrest is always the same when leaving a factory, and the arrangement is not suitable for children with different heights.

Detailed Description
As shown in fig. 1 to 8, the utility model discloses a novel seat 100 for on perambulator, the perambulator includes a frame 200 that can change between expansion state and fold condition, seat 100 include one take seat 1 and downside pin joint in taking seat 1 lean against 2, take seat 1 connect in frame 200, seat 100 still includes a headrest 3, just headrest 3 can connect in the 2 upsides of leaning against with relatively reciprocating.
In this embodiment, the headrest 3 is connected to the upper side of a sliding tube 4, the backrest 2 is connected to a fixing tube 5, and the lower side of the sliding tube 4 is slidably connected to the fixing tube 5 up and down. Preferably, the headrest 3 is fixedly connected to an upper side of the sliding tube 4.
A limiting device used for limiting the relative sliding of the fixed tube 5 and the sliding tube 4 is arranged between the fixed tube 5 and the sliding tube 4, and the limiting device can be unlocked to adjust the relative height of the sliding tube 4 and the fixed tube 5, namely the height of the headrest 3 relative to the backrest 2. The fixed pipe 5 pipe wall is provided with a plurality of locating holes 51 from top to bottom at the interval, sliding tube 4 is provided with a perforation 41 on the pipe wall of corresponding side, works as perforation 41 corresponds with one of them locating hole 51 when corresponding, one side of stop device passes in this locating hole 51 is inserted again behind the perforation 41, at this moment, so, sliding tube 4 and fixed pipe 5 can not reciprocate relatively, head rest 3 is located a relative height with back 2.
In this embodiment, the limiting device is a V-shaped elastic sheet 6, the V-shaped elastic sheet 6 is disposed in the sliding tube 4, a protruding point 61 is disposed on one side of the V-shaped elastic sheet 6, and when the through hole 41 corresponds to one of the positioning holes 51, the protruding point 61 penetrates through the through hole 41 and is clamped into the positioning hole 51 under the elastic force of the V-shaped elastic sheet 6, so that the sliding tube 4 and the fixing tube 5 cannot move up and down relatively. The V-shaped elastic sheet 6 is of a known structure, and one side of the convex point 61, which is far away from the sliding tube 4, is provided with an arc-shaped surface which is an inclined surface from top to bottom.
When the height of a child is high and the headrest 3 needs to be adjusted upwards, the headrest 3 is pulled upwards, so that the sliding tube 4 and the V-shaped elastic sheet 6 are also pulled upwards, the V-shaped elastic sheet 6 can be elastically deformed, when the headrest is pulled upwards, one side of the convex point 61, which is far away from the sliding tube 4, can be in contact with the top wall of the positioning hole 51, the convex point 61 is moved towards the sliding tube 4 under the stress to be separated from the positioning hole 51 and retract into the fixing tube 5, the limiting device is unlocked, at the moment, the headrest 3 is continuously pulled upwards, the convex point 61 is in contact with the inner wall of the fixing tube 5, the V-shaped elastic sheet 6 is always in a pressed state, and when the other positioning hole 51 is aligned with the through hole 41, the convex point 61 is clamped into the positioning hole 51 due to the restoring force of the V-shaped elastic sheet 6, so that the headrest 3 and the backrest 2 are positioned at. If the height is proper, the headrest 3 is not needed to be adjusted, and if the height is not proper, the headrest 3 is pulled upwards continuously until the convex points 61 of the V-shaped elastic sheets 6 are clamped into the positioning holes 51 corresponding to the required height, the headrest 3 is positioned at the proper relative height, and the head of the child can be very comfortably leaned on the headrest 3.
When the height of the child is short and the headrest 3 needs to be adjusted downwards, the headrest 3 is pressed downwards, so that the bottom wall of the positioning hole 51 is in contact with one side of the convex point 61 away from the sliding tube 4 to provide a thrust force to the convex point 61, the convex point 61 is separated from the positioning hole 51 and retracts into the fixing tube 5, the headrest 3 is pressed downwards continuously until the convex point 61 of the V-shaped elastic sheet 6 is clamped with the positioning hole 51 with the corresponding height to position the headrest 3 at the corresponding height, and the head of the child can be comfortably leaned on the headrest 3. The specific adjustment principle is the same as that for adjusting the headrest 3 upwards, and therefore, the details are not described herein.
Therefore, the relative height of the headrest 3 can be adjusted according to the height of a child, and when the height of the headrest 3 relative to the backrest 2 needs to be adjusted, the headrest 3 only needs to be moved up and down, so that the adjustment operation is simple and convenient. The backrest 2 comprises a body 21 and a lower rear cover 22 fixedly connected to the rear side of the body 21, and the fixing tube 5 is fixedly connected between the body 21 and the lower rear cover 22. The headrest 3 comprises a main body 31 and an upper back cover 32 fixedly connected to the rear side of the main body 31, and the upper end of the sliding tube 4 is fixedly connected between the main body 31 and the upper back cover 32. Thus, the sliding tube 4 and the fixed tube 5 are mostly covered, thereby playing a role of protection.
The seat 100 is further provided with a limiting device for limiting the sliding tube 4 to be separated from the fixed tube 5 upwards, the limiting device comprises a limiting block 71 and a limiting tube 72 fixedly connected with the fixed tube 5 relatively, the lower side of the limiting tube 72 extends into the fixed tube 5, the lower side of the limiting tube 72 is located between the fixed tube 5 and the sliding tube 4, and the lower end surface of the limiting tube 72 is not lower than the top wall of the uppermost positioning hole 51; stopper 71 is connected in the lower extreme of sliding tube 4, and stopper 71 one side also toward the extension of one side of fixed pipe inner wall, so, when upwards pulling head rest 3 to a certain position, stopper 71 this side contacts with spacing pipe 72 lower extreme, and at this moment, sliding tube 4 can not upwards remove again to avoid sliding tube 4 upwards to break away from fixed pipe 5.
In this embodiment, the sliding tube 4 and the stopper 71 are integrally formed in an inverted T shape. Preferably, the limiting block 71 is integrally in an inverted T shape, the vertical portion 711 of the inverted T-shaped limiting block 71 extends into the lower end of the sliding tube 4 and is fixedly connected with the sliding tube 4, the horizontal portion 712 of the inverted T-shaped limiting block 71 is located outside the lower end of the sliding tube 4, and the size of the horizontal portion is larger than the tube diameter of the lower end of the sliding tube 4. Thus, the sliding tube 4 is connected with the limiting block 71 and then integrally formed into an inverted T shape, so that when the sliding tube 4 slides upwards to a certain position, the transverse part 712 of the inverted T-shaped limiting block 71 abuts against the lower end of the limiting tube 72. That is, the stopper 71 also extends toward the inner wall of the fixed pipe, i.e., the lateral portion 712.
In this embodiment, the tube wall of the limiting tube 72 is provided with a clamping portion 721, one end of the clamping portion 721 is connected to the limiting tube 72, the other end of the clamping portion 721 is not connected to the limiting tube 72, and the other end of the clamping portion 721 not connected to the limiting tube 72 is protruded with a clamping point 722, so that the clamping portion 721 has a certain elastic deformation; correspondingly, the fixed pipe 5 is provided with a connecting hole 52. In the process of inserting the limiting tube 72 into the fixing tube 5, the fastening point 722 is always pressed by the inner wall of the fixing tube 5, and when the fastening point 722 is aligned with the connecting hole 52, the fastening point 722 is fastened into the connecting hole 52 under the restoring force of the fastening part 721, so that the limiting tube 72 is relatively fixedly connected with the fixing tube 5.
Preferably, an outer flange 723 is arranged on the upper side of the limiting pipe 72, and the outer flange 723 abuts against the upper end of the fixing pipe 5. In this way, when the outer flange 723 abuts against the upper end of the fixed pipe 5 when the limiting pipe 72 and the fixed pipe 5 are assembled, the fastening point 722 is fastened into the connecting hole 52 of the fixed pipe 5. Therefore, the assembly is more convenient and clear.
In this embodiment, preferably, the limiting tube 72 and the outer flange 723 are integrally formed and made of plastic, that is, the plastic limiting tube 72 and the plastic outer flange 723, and for supporting strength, the sliding tube 4 and the fixed tube 5 are both steel tubes, and the plastic limiting tube 72 and the plastic outer flange 723 are arranged, so that the limiting function can be achieved, and the rigid contact between the rigid sliding tube 4 and the fixed tube 5 can be avoided, so that the sliding tube 4 is prevented from being scratched by the upper edge of the fixed tube 5 in the assembling process and the up-and-down sliding process to cause smooth sliding and further influence on the headrest adjustment function.
